So Julie, (who totally rocks, by the way) wrote to me to say that she a a proud owner of the Martha Ice Pop Molds. She has the classic kind, not the "tower pops". She also was kind enough to share her favorite recipe which I am going to post here, because it sounds so wonderful:

Julie's favorite popsicle is:
-combine equal amounts of water and sugar in a saucepan, heat until sugar is dissolved. Add a few tablespoons lime juice and/or grated ginger. Stir and heat a bit more.
-cut up 3 or 4 mangoes, put in blender. -strain sugar mixture if you used ginger.
-blend mangoes and enough of the sugar mixture to make a pretty thick smoothie, pour into popsicle molds, freeze. (you can always refrigerate any leftover sugar syrup for next time)
Yum!

A few weeks ago on Glitter, someone posted about Jell-o Pudding Pops. Remember those? I used to love them so much. I had completely forgotten about them until I stumble upon that thread. Here is the recipe from that thread:

GENERIC PUDDING POPS: A Recipe
1 (4 ounce) package instant chocolate pudding mix
2 cups milk
1/4 cup sugar
1 cup canned evaporated milk

Combine pudding and milk in a large mixer bowl. Beat for two minutes. Stir in sugar and canned milk. Pour into popsicle molds and freeze.
